This is the first time I've ever posted anything on-line about anyone, let alone a contractor!
I called Mansfield Landscaping for a simple estimate to have my flower beds redone. The owner asked me to answer four very short questions. I answered and I told him that I simply wanted to redo my flower beds, that I saw him on Angie's list, I had received his promotional flyers in the mail and that I'd like to arrange for an estimate. He told me that before he could do that I must give him a few minutes so he can run through the process. I said that would be OK. After listening quietly to a sales pitch, not for a few minutes but for exactly 16 minutes I told him I needed to get back to work and could we schedule an estimate. He asked me NOT TO INTERUPT HIM! After another minute I asked again for an estimate and the phone line went dead. I called back and told him that we'd been disconnected but he told me that he's "hung up purposefully because it's obvious that if you can't give me any time we'll could never get along!" I was dumbstruck!!! I quietly gave him 17 minutes to do his sales talk and he hung up on me! Just totally rude and obnoxious. He expects potential customers to give him the courtesy of our time but he didn't have any respect for my time. The strangest phone call ever with a contractor. If he's this rude and obnoxious on the telephone how does he ever successfully satisfy his customers??? Go ahead and call him and see if he doesn't do the same thing to you if you interrupt him. Mansfield does beautiful, quality work in a very timely matter. Mr. Mansfield has a very large ego and has seminars that you may attend and he will tell you how he does business. He presents a plan with a price and you can take it or leave it....no option of thinking it over. He also asks his customers to write a review which he will post on TOTV. There is nothing wrong with his business practices but his personality is not for everyone. He has done many beautiful yards in our neighbor hood and most were satisfied. We did not choose to go with him as I did not feel he would be someone I would enjoy working with.
